**First-day checklist — Item 9: Interview room**

Walk the new starter past Room 1.12, our secure interview room at Marroway Court. Quick rundown: candidates never enter unaccompanied, blinds stay down during sessions, and the whiteboard gets wiped after each one. They'll occasionally be asked to unlock it for hiring managers, so make sure they know the door code shown below.

turnstile pass: bdg-PD-2

Release checklist — item 7: health checks behind the Kestrelgate load balancer. Before promoting, confirm the new /ready endpoint returns 200 only after the cache warmer finishes; the old endpoint lied during warmup and the balancer routed traffic into cold nodes, which caused the Brindle launch wobble. Verify drain timeout is set above the warmer's worst-case duration, and that both availability zones report healthy independently. Reviewer should sign off only after comparing the deployed artifact against the reference noted below.

trace token, yafog-bafop: htk31_90e4e3962168bb1bf8de5dfe86ea527

Over a 72-hour soak, open descriptors climbed from ~300 to 14,000, eventually hitting the ulimit and stalling intake. Instrumentation points to the retry path in the archive fetcher, where sockets are not closed on TLS handshake failure. Patch adds deferred closes and a descriptor-count gauge exported to the Harrowfen dashboard. No data exposure observed; failure mode is availability only. Security review requested on the error-handling changes. Sign-off is required from the engineer named below.

named custodian: Belius Casath Ulaix Sorius

Subject: DR drill on Thursday — Whisperhall audio guide

Welcome aboard, everyone. This Thursday we simulate a full outage of the Whisperhall audio-guide backend for the Torvane Gallery. We'll restore tour content from cold backups and verify playback on test handsets. Follow the drill sheet carefully and log every step. To unlock the restore vault, use the recovery passphrase shown below.

unlock words, tawif-tahop: oliys-ulawyn-tamdor-lamys-casox-jormir-fraius-kasath-ulador-ulamir-holir-sorys-holeth